Lotlot de Leon’s cryptic Instagram posts spark conversations on truth and deception

Actress Lotlot de Leon recently stirred speculation online after posting cryptic messages about lies and truth on her Instagram Stories
Lotlot de Leon caused a buzz on social media after sharing a series of enigmatic posts on her Instagram Stories, prompting fans to wonder about the messages behind her words.



In her initial post, Lotlot shared a compelling quote: “People who use others as stepping stone will one day lose their balance.” This was followed by a graphic featuring a meter with labels “truth” on one end and “lie” on the other, with the needle pointed squarely at “lie.” Her final post proclaimed, “The truth always comes out.” Although Lotlot did not reveal any background or explanation for these posts, they triggered much speculation across social media platforms.

While the precise intent of her posts remains unclear, many followers found the content meaningful, sparking thoughtful conversations about honesty and deception.

Lotlot de Leon is the adopted daughter of Nora Aunor and Christopher de Leon, two of the Philippines’ most revered figures in entertainment. Despite complexities in her family relationships, Lotlot has consistently shown profound respect and love for her late mother. In honor of what would have been Nora’s 72nd birthday, Lotlot paid tribute by sharing an image of her mother’s tombstone inscribed with “Mommy,” accompanied by the heartfelt caption, “Happy birthday in heaven, mommy! I will always love you.”

Nora Aunor, often hailed as the “Superstar of Philippine Cinema,” had an illustrious career spanning more than five decades with over 170 film credits. In 2022, she was honored with the National Artist title for Film and Broadcast Arts, cementing her legacy as one of the country’s most influential cultural icons. Her death in April 2025 marked the end of a significant era in Philippine entertainment.

Lotlot’s recent posts came shortly after Nora Aunor was posthumously awarded the Presidential Medal of Merit, an accolade that Lotlot proudly shared with gratitude, thanking the President and First Lady, as well as fans who continue to celebrate Nora’s impact on Filipino culture.

Furthermore, it was confirmed by a Palace official that the Office of the President and President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. personally took responsibility for the late superstar’s hospital bills and outstanding debts, ensuring that Nora Aunor’s family was supported during this difficult time.
